Flyers bad luck continues

By Michael Rushton

Well, it just seems as if the hockey gods just wanted to stick it to the Flyers one last time.

Despite having a 48.2 percent chance at landing the first overall pick in 2007 NHL draft, the Flyers will pick second. That's because Chicago cashed in on its eight percent chance and landed the number one pick.

By rule, the Flyers could fall no further than second, which is where the team will select from when the draft goes down on June 22.

Phoenix will pick third in the draft, while Los Angeles and Washington round out the top five.
